I tried cinema 4d for some time and i have to say there many things there that I would like to see in 3ds max.
One of those things is that I like in C4D, is that if you have a selected polygon you dont need to have the mouse over the polygon to extrude it, you can simply click anywhere on the work area.
In max i need to lock the selection to be able to do that.
My questions are:
Is there a script that turn this possible in max?
Or is there a option in max that make this possible?.
